Cell phone lost in Kresge Library

On Sunday, April 1 at 9 p.m., a female student left her cell phone on the towel dispenser in the third floor restroom in Kresge Library. The phone was missing when the student returned to the restroom at approximately 12:01 a.m.

The student told police she had pinged her phone and was able to use a GPS to locate it. The GPS showed that the phone was in an apartment complex in Auburn Hills. After 1:15 p.m. on Monday, April 2, the  GPS did not receive a signal indicating where the phone was located. Police are investigating the incident.

 

Instructor’s email account hacked 

On Friday, March 8, an OU special instructor met with OUPD to discuss pressing criminal charges against a family member who she said accessed her webmail account without permission. The instructor also told police she believed her phone had been tampered with and she wanted to change the locks to her office.

The instructor said that on Feb. 24 at approximately 6:57a.m., her email was accessed by someone other than herself.

The instructor told police that nobody had her password or permission to access the account. The instructor was told by the OU IT department that one IP addressed that accessed the webmail account was from an account that did not belong to her.
